> Casts are ugly and they hide bugs. There is a fix
> for this problem: make u64 be "unsigned long long"
> for every arch. That works for both 32-bit and 64-bit
> systems. Likewise, choose "unsigned" for u32 even
> if an "unsigned long" would work for a given arch.
>
> That merely hides the lack of user defined printf types
> in gcc, it doesn't make the real problem go away.
> What you suggest is merely a bandaid.
Sure. It's an obviously useful bandaid that works
with gcc 2.91, 2.92, 2.95, 2.96, 3.0, 3.2, 3.3, etc.
